Around the peak of the last ice age — say, around 18,000 years ago — there were glaciers in Alaska in all the same places you see them today — and then some! Today, Earth and Sky answers a listener’s question about glaciers.

As climate warms and cools over centuries, rainfall patterns also shift. Find out how scientists in Israel are using cave formations to anticipate changes in the amount of rainfall over the Middle East on today’s Earth and Sky.
